Progressive Web Apps (PWAs) are a secure option for users as they prioritize security in their design and implementation. Here are some key points to consider:
HTTPS as a Prerequisite:
PWAs require the use of HTTPS as a prerequisite. This ensures that the data exchanged between the app and the server is encrypted and protected from unauthorized access. HTTPS provides a secure connection, safeguarding sensitive information.
Web Security Best Practices:
PWAs follow web security best practices, such as implementing content security policies and sandboxing techniques. These measures aim to prevent malicious activity, such as cross-site scripting (XSS) attacks, cross-site request forgery (CSRF) attacks, and clickjacking.
Reduced Vulnerability:
PWAs are less vulnerable to malware and phishing attacks compared to native apps. This is due to the fact that PWAs are served through the web, making it easier for developers to detect and block malicious behavior. Furthermore, PWAs cannot be granted excessive permissions like native apps, reducing the potential for abuse.
Regular Updates and Maintenance:
PWAs are regularly updated and maintained by developers. This allows them to quickly address any security vulnerabilities that may arise. Updates can be deployed seamlessly to users without requiring them to manually update the app, ensuring that users always have the latest security patches.
In conclusion, Progressive Web Apps provide a secure and reliable user experience. By implementing HTTPS, adhering to web security best practices, reducing vulnerability to malware and phishing attacks, and ensuring regular updates, PWAs prioritize the security of user data and interactions.